Hoyt Richard Clevenger, Jr.

Hoyt Richard Clevenger, Jr., of Liberty, Texas, passed away Saturday, June 20, 2026, in Baytown.

Hoyt was born May 4, 1952, in Nashville, Tenn., to parents, Hoyt Richard Clevenger, Sr. and Kathleen Hood-Clevenger, a former resident of Pasadena, and has resided in Liberty since 1996.

He graduated from Lane Tech High School in Chicago, Illinois, received his Bachelor of Science (B.S.) in Communications from Lamar University, and was a chemical plant operator from numerous companies, and retired from Training and Development Systems (TDS) in Beaumont, where he wrote operational procedural manuals for companies like Chevron-Phillips in Saudi Arabia. Hoyt enjoyed playing the guitar, writing music, and computers, where he designed motherboards with his company PC Tours.
